My 2004 Pontiac aztek runs great unless you have to go up a hill or pass someone on the highway. Three different mechanics including the dealership can't figure this out. When u accelerate more than...

Loss of power at highway speed is usually clogged fuel filter or clogged air filter. Checking fuel pressure won't tell you if the filter is clogging up. You can still have pressure, just no volume. Air filters can do the same, except it will usually die or stumble coming to stops. The abs and disable light won't affect the engine performance. Hopefully you have a bad wheel sensor that is also disabling the AWD. The sensor is around $100 the actuator for the AWD is over $300

Symptoms 2000 kia sportage Symptoms 2000 kia sportage does not do all the time. Starts runs well but driving road 50mph almost as if ignition shut off split 2nd. Stop car and while running in drive s

Some makers used Vacuum releases for their emergency brakes which had a Vacuum switch connected to the shift assembly. This would account for a stumble if Vacuum vented out through this switch.

More common for shifting stumble to occur from Park to Drive, engaging a load on the engine, not to stumble to a freewheeling Park position. Sounds like idle speed control is sluggish to stabilize the motor.

You also have idle speed control problem with A/C, kind of shows that A/C was what kept the engine running because when you turned the A/C off, the car died.

I am going to give you some Websites for wiring diagrams. Alldatadiy.com amd Autozone.com with free wiring info upon registering your vehicle.

It seems that the base Idle speed control is not working and the A/C idle speed control is.

Also check for Vacuum leaks on the intake manifold by spraying water from a pumpbottle on the seams of the gaskets.

Check ignition Relay or ignition switch for random cutouts. The fusebox layout is on the Autozone site.
